The Tough Cultural Roots of Appalachia
This chapter explores the violent history and cultural identity of the Appalachian people, tracing their herding ancestry and the Scots-Irish influences that shaped their tough demeanor. It contrasts Appalachian customs with those of early settlers in more established regions, shedding light on differing attitudes toward property and life.
